Lewis H. Latimer was an amazing man. The son of slaves, he was a self-taught American inventor and draftsman, and a colleague of Alexander Bell, Hiram Maxim and Thomas Edison. During his lifetime, Lewis had seven patents credited to his name. He was a founding member of the Edison Pioneers, a group of Edison’s close friends and colleagues.
